emacs-elpa-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[elpa] externals/undo-tree bc9d095 156/195: Clear undo-tree-visualizer-n


From: Stefan Monnier
Subject: [elpa] externals/undo-tree bc9d095 156/195: Clear undo-tree-visualizer-needs-extending-[up|down] before drawing tree.
Date: Sat, 28 Nov 2020 13:41:43 -0500 (EST)

branch: externals/undo-tree
commit bc9d09555f5aeac6ac4684d748be763f64a7d80a
Author: Toby S. Cubitt <toby-undo-tree@dr-qubit.org>
Commit: Toby S. Cubitt <toby-undo-tree@dr-qubit.org>

    Clear undo-tree-visualizer-needs-extending-[up|down] before drawing tree.
    
    Fixes bug that could trigger an error when redrawing the tree after toggling
    timestamps.
---
 undo-tree.el |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/undo-tree.el b/undo-tree.el
index cacd258..07889e9 100644
--- a/undo-tree.el
+++ b/undo-tree.el
@@ -3,7 +3,7 @@
 ;; Copyright (C) 2009-2013  Free Software Foundation, Inc
 
 ;; Author: Toby Cubitt <toby-undo-tree@dr-qubit.org>
-;; Version: 0.6.4
+;; Version: 0.6.5
 ;; Keywords: convenience, files, undo, redo, history, tree
 ;; URL: http://www.dr-qubit.org/emacs.php
 ;; Repository: http://www.dr-qubit.org/git/undo-tree.git
@@ -3184,6 +3184,8 @@ signaling an error if file is not found."
                  (undo-tree-current undo-tree)
                (undo-tree-root undo-tree))))
     (erase-buffer)
+    (setq undo-tree-visualizer-needs-extending-down nil
+         undo-tree-visualizer-needs-extending-up nil)
     (undo-tree-clear-visualizer-data undo-tree)
     (undo-tree-compute-widths node)
     ;; lazy drawing starts vertically centred and displaced horizontally to



reply via email to

[Prev in Thread] Current Thread [Next in Thread]